Ingredients You’ll Need
To whip up this delightful salad,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 2 cups cooked chicken (shredded or diced, preferably rotisserie for convenience)
- 1 cup dill pickles (chopped, with some juice reserved)
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ise (or Greek yogurt for a healthier version)
- 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ard (optional for an extra kick)
- 1/4 cup red onion (finely chopped)
- 1/4 cup celery (chopped for crunch)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on fresh dill (or 1 teaspoon dried dill for flavor)
Optional Add-ins
Feel free to get creative! Consider adding:
- Chopped hard-boiled eggs for added protein
- Sliced grapes or apples for a touch of sweetness
- Chopped nuts or seeds for a crunchy texture
- Avocado for creaminess and healthy fats
Directions
Here’s how to make your Dill Pickle Chicken Salad:
Prepare the Chicken: If you haven’t done so already, shred or dice the cooked chicken into bite-sized pieces.
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the chicken, chopped dill pickles, red onion, celery, and fresh dill.
Add Dressing: In a separate b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ise and Dijon mustard until smooth. Pour the dressing over the chicken mixture and stir until all ingredients are well-coated.
Season: Add salt and pepper to taste. If you want an extra kick, consider adding a splash of reserved pickle juice!
Chill: Cover the salad and let it chill in the fridge for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
Serve: Enjoy your Dill Pickle Chicken Salad on its own, on a bed of greens, or as a filling for a sandwich or wrap.
Serving Suggestions
To serve your Dill Pickle Chicken Salad, consider these delicious options:
- In a Sandwich: Layer the salad between slices of your favorite bread with some lettuce and tomato.
- With Crackers: Serve it with whole-grain or gluten-free crackers for a satisfying snack.
- In a Lettuce Wrap: For a low-carb option, scoop the salad into crisp lettuce leaves and enjoy!
